SPDR S&P 400 Mid Cap Value ETF

77 hedge funds and large institutions have $110M invested in SPDR S&P 400 Mid Cap Value ETF in 2017 Q2 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 11 funds opening new positions, 38 increasing their positions, 19 reducing their positions, and 11 closing their positions.
